      Four crus, two years in oak, one clear direction—Barbaresco, shot straight. Fletcher Recta Pete Barbaresco 2022 is a wine with precision and pulse. It’s built from four iconic Barbaresco crus—Faset, Ca’ Grossa, Serragrilli and Ronchi—and named for winemaker David Fletcher’s ancestral motto, Recta Pete (Latin for “shoot straight”). This is Nebbiolo made with focus: 100% destemmed, open fermented, and aged gently for 24 months in seasoned 300L barrels before release. The result is elegant, fragrant, and unmistakably Barbaresco.

      The blend speaks volumes. Faset brings perfume, Ca’ Grossa adds depth, Serragrilli lifts the mid-palate, and Ronchi locks in structure. This vintage walks the line between classic and contemporary. You'll see notes of red cherry, rose petal, spice, and liquorice glide across a palate framed by fine, persistent tannins and a mineral core. Serious but not stiff, it’s a standout for collectors and Nebbiolo newcomers alike.

      Cherry, almond, liquorice and aniseed, a dusting of baking spice. It’s medium to full-bodied, red fruits with a nice crunch to acidity, tannin has a gently dusty and peppery profile, the perfume is present, and the wine, despite the warm vintage, has a cool and pleasing ‘mineral’ character to it. Finish is crisp and long, with some orange peel bite to close. Excellent.

      — Gary Walsh, The Wine Front, 94 Points

      David Fletcher’s journey to producing exceptional Nebbiolo began in 2004, when his passion for this iconic Italian grape led him to Italy. Immersing himself in the traditions of Barbaresco and Barolo, he honed his craft and dedication to Nebbiolo, ultimately creating Fletcher Wines to blend his love for Italian winemaking with Australia’s unique terroir. By 2012, Fletcher settled in Barbaresco, where he continues to produce wines that reflect both the best of Italian tradition and Australian innovation.

      Fletcher’s self-professed obsession with Nebbiolo has become the cornerstone of his winemaking philosophy. An Australian by birth, Fletcher’s journey to the Langhe hills of Piemonte was driven by an undeniable passion for Nebbiolo’s transcendent quality, and now, he calls Barbaresco home. Starting his winemaking career early, Fletcher didn’t inherit a winery or follow a family tradition—his passion for winemaking grew organically, alongside his love for the land and the grape variety he reveres. Today, Fletcher’s wines are a testament to his dedication, not only to Nebbiolo but to the unique expression it can have in both Italy and Australia. With the production of no more than 25,000 bottles annually, Fletcher Wines remains a highly sought-after, small-scale winery with a focus on quality over quantity. His ability to craft world-class Nebbiolo, alongside his expanding portfolio of wines, is a reflection of his ongoing commitment to pushing boundaries and continuing the exploration of this exceptional grape.
